Bray Head:
No trip to Bray is complete without conquering Bray Head. This dramatic cliff walk offers breathtaking panoramic views of the Irish Sea, Bray town, and the Wicklow Mountains. The path is well-maintained, but remember to wear comfortable shoes and be mindful of the weather conditions. Pack a picnic and enjoy a truly unforgettable lunch with a view! The challenging climb is well worth the reward.
Bray Harbour:
Bray Harbour is a bustling hub of activity. Watch the boats come and go, grab a delicious fish and chips from one of the many seaside restaurants, or simply relax and soak in the atmosphere. It's a great place for people-watching and enjoying the salty sea air. The harbour also offers various boat trips, providing a unique perspective of the coastline.
The People's Park:
Escape the hustle and bustle and find tranquility in the People's Park. This beautiful Victorian park offers stunning flower displays, serene walking paths, and a playground for children. It's the perfect place for a relaxing stroll or a family picnic. Don't miss the bandstand, a charming reminder of Bray's rich history.

Planning Your Bray Adventure:
To ensure a smooth and enjoyable trip, consider these tips:
- Transportation: Bray is easily accessible by car, bus, and train from Dublin.
- Accommodation: A wide range of accommodation options are available, from budget-friendly guesthouses to luxury hotels.
- Weather: Ireland's weather can be unpredictable, so pack layers and be prepared for all conditions.
